Kuraine - power cycle[^] This was just a random recommendation by Spotify last week. This EP is also their only release on Spotify, apart from a song for the Celeste game soundtrack (never heard of that game either). Kuraine, and for me power cycle in particular, sounds like a remixed classic (S)NES game soundtrack. It turns out she's actually a game developer. From Wikipedia: "Lena "Kuraine" Raine (born February 29, 1984), also known as Lena Chappelle, is an American-Canadian composer, producer, and video game developer." Seems I'll be checking out her other aliases too (they're modern classical soundtracks). Composer of the week! :D
